и безболезненный пусть добавить остальные колонки в ключ??
нельзя добавлять в ключ существующие колонки, надо пересоздавать таблицу. Можно добавлять новые типа alter table final_states_by_month add column t String, modify order by (uid,t) у вас прод? если нет, я бы все переделал на primary key https://clickhouse.yandex/docs/ru/operations/table_engines/mergetree/#pervichnyi-kliuch-otlichnyi-ot-kliucha-sortirovki Существует возможность задать первичный ключ (выражение, значения которого будут записаны в индексный файл для каждой засечки), отличный от ключа сортировки (выражения, по которому будут упорядочены строки в кусках данных)
Обсуждают сегодня